Original Description
The masterpiece Bildnis Franz I., Kaiser Des Heiligen Romischen Reichs by Martin van Meytens the Younger captures Emperor Francis I of the Holy Roman Empire in a striking portrait that radiates regal poise and Baroque grandeur. Painted circa 1745, the work exemplifies Meytens' meticulous detail and luxurious coloration, characteristic of his refined courtly style. The emperor is depicted adorned in gleaming armor and flowing drapery, set against an opulent backdrop that underscores Habsburg authority and sophistication. Meytens, as Vienna's foremost portraitist of his era, infused his subjects with lifelike precision while maintaining the formal elegance demanded by imperial patrons. This painting holds significant historical importance, not only as a testament to Habsburg propaganda but also as a prime example of 18th-century aristocratic portraiture—bridging the late Baroque and emerging Rococo sensibilities. Its artistic merit lies in the delicate interplay of textures, from embroidered silks to polished metal, rendered with virtuosic skill.
